Summerville's Stunner Fires Netherlands Past Japan at World Cup
Soccer Jun 14, 2026 2 min read

Summerville's Stunner Fires Netherlands Past Japan at World Cup

The Dutch-born Surinamese winger delivered a moment of magic to put the Oranje back in front against Japan in Group F.

Crysencio Summerville lit up the 2026 World Cup with a thunderbolt that restored Netherlands' advantage against Japan in their crucial Group F encounter. The Leeds United winger, whose Surinamese heritage connects him to South America's vibrant football diaspora, unleashed a strike that had fans on their feet and reminded everyone why the Dutch remain one of world football's most exciting teams.

The goal showcased the kind of individual brilliance that has made Summerville one of Europe's most talked-about young talents. Rising through the ranks at Feyenoord before making his mark in English football, the 22-year-old represents the new generation of players carrying Dutch football forward on the global stage.

This World Cup continues to highlight football's truly global nature, with players of diverse backgrounds representing nations across multiple confederations. Summerville's impact mirrors the contributions of African diaspora players who have elevated teams throughout the tournament, proving once again that talent knows no borders.

The Netherlands will look to build on this momentum as they push for qualification from Group F, with Summerville's versatility and pace providing coach Ronald Koeman with a dynamic weapon in attack. If this strike is any indication, the young winger could be set for a breakout tournament on football's biggest stage.
